it.amattioli.applicate.commands
Class AbstractEditingListManager<T>

Show UML class diagram
java.lang.Object
  extended by it.amattioli.applicate.commands.AbstractEditingListManager<T>
All Implemented Interfaces:
EditingListManager<T>, it.amattioli.dominate.util.PropertyChangeEmitter
Direct Known Subclasses:
DefaultEditingListManager

public abstract class AbstractEditingListManager<T>
extends Object
implements EditingListManager<T>


Constructor Summary
AbstractEditingListManager()
           
 
Method Summary
 void addPropertyChangeListener(PropertyChangeListener listener)
           
protected  void firePropertyChange(String propertyName, Object oldValue, Object newValue)
           
 List<T> getEditingList()
           
 void removePropertyChangeListener(PropertyChangeListener listener)
           
 void setEditingList(List<T> editingList)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face it.amattioli.applicate.commands.EditingListManager
addRow, canDeleteRow, createElementEditor, deleteRow
 

Constructor Detail

AbstractEditingListManager

public AbstractEditingListManager()
Method Detail

firePropertyChange

protected void firePropertyChange(String propertyName,
                                  Object oldValue,
                                  Object newValue)

addPropertyChangeListener

public void addPropertyChangeListener(PropertyChangeListener listener)
Specified by:
addPropertyChangeListener in interface it.amattioli.dominate.util.PropertyChangeEmitter

removePropertyChangeListener

public void removePropertyChangeListener(PropertyChangeListener listener)
Specified by:
removePropertyChangeListener in interface it.amattioli.dominate.util.PropertyChangeEmitter

getEditingList

public List<T> getEditingList()
Specified by:
getEditingList in interface EditingListManager<T>

setEditingList

public void setEditingList(List<T> editingList)
Specified by:
setEditingList in interface EditingListManager<T>


Copyright © 2011. All Rights Reserved.